Fairy Pirate Ship?


"arrr matey" isn't something one usually imagines coming out of a fairy's mouth...unless you are 4 and 6 year old boys. But when our friend Stephen, at the last workshop, offered to let me turn his curved piece of palm bark into a ship for the boys, Phineas couldn't resist. There is a bunk bed and dining area below decks, a turn-able captains wheel, and a pine cone crows nest.

Now the pirates and the fairy pirates battle it out in our driveway- where the ship is washed away in cement storms and margarita daisy bush whirlpools. Its a bit like Waldorf vs. the mainstream, since the one team seems to be small handmade gnome felt dolls, with wool faces. And the other team is made up of small plastic pirate figurines. Actually- I think its wonderful that my boys navigate the stormy educational seas with both, their imaginations easily mapping the middle ground.
